Bloody and intensely compelling. I first read this book when I was 14 and it blew my mind. I don't think I had ever read anything quite so explicitly violent before that point. (Unless you count the Armoured Bear fight in Northern Lights...)

The elements of the original Icelandic saga are so seamlessly interwoven with Burgess's vision of dystopian London, that it is no more surprising that Odin turns up at a banquet than that there are mutants - half animal, half person - roaming around outside the city walls.
